Alameda Health System (AHS), formerly Alameda County Medical Center (ACMC), is an integrated public health care system [1] organized as a public hospital authority. [ 2 ] Formerly operated by Alameda County , California , it now has an independent board of trustees appointed by the Alameda County Board of Supervisors .

Alameda Hospital is a hospital in Alameda, California, United States.. The hospital was founded in 1894. Up until 2002, it was a private non-profit hospital. In 2002, Alameda voters approved a $298 per year parcel tax, and the hospital became a district hospital with the formation of the Alameda Health Care District.
